The story of Earl Pitts began in 1898 in Adonis, Polk, Missouri, United States. In 1900, Earl Pitts resided in Greene, Polk, Missouri, USA. In 1910, Earl Pitts resided in Strike Axe, Osage, Oklahoma, USA. Earl Pitts married Ellen Duncan, and had children including William Earl Pitts, Willis D Pitts. Earl Pitts passed away in 1973 in Newkirk, Kay County, Oklahoma, USA.
